Tasting Note

The 2020 vintage has aromas of fennel, fresh quince and ruby grapefruit. On the palate, notes of citrus peel and roasted almond are complemented by an inviting phenolic grip, full palate and jubilant freshness typical of this site.

Product Notes

Mullineux Schist Swartland Chenin Blanc is a wine made from a single block of old vines grown in the Swartland region of South Africa. The grapes are carefully handpicked and the wine is fermented and aged in a combination of old oak barrels and concrete eggs to preserve the fresh fruit flavors while adding complexity and texture. The wine exhibits aromas of ripe peach and apricot, with hints of honey and spice. On the palate, it is full-bodied and creamy, with flavors of ripe tropical fruit, citrus, and a mineral-driven finish. This well-balanced wine is a perfect match for spicy Asian dishes or grilled seafood.

About the Winery

Mullineux

If you are looking for a taste of authentic South African wines with utmost character and elegance, Mullineux is the right choice for you. These wines are hand-crafted and produced in the rich granite and schist soils based in Swartland, South Africa.  Chris and Andrea worked in many wineries across France, South Africa and California. They put all their winemaking experience into the brand they created, Mullineux, in South Africa’s Swartland region. As soon as Chris and Andrea spotted the terroirs, climatic conditions and the soil qualities of this region, they knew that this was where they wanted to set up their label.
